What can I see and do near Hokaiji Temple?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at Tale of Genji Museum, Nintendo Museum or Kyoto National Museum. Fushimi Castle, Uji Bridge and Tofuku-ji Temple are well-known local landmarks worth a visit. Consider spending a leisurely afternoon outside at Byodo-in Temple, Shoseien Garden or Manpuku-ji.
How can I get to Hokaiji Temple?
With so many transport options, exploring the area around Hokaiji Temple is easy. Take advantage of metro transport at JR Fujinomori Station, Kuinabashi Station and Inari Station. If you want to see more of the area, hop aboard a train from Fujinomori Station, Sumizome Station or Fushimi Station.
